Target Audience


The first important factor is the target audience! When we talk about iOS users, they are more tech-savvy and often live in developed countries. Whereas, Android, on the other hand, has a larger global user base in developing nations.

However, you must know that Android has 70% of the global market when it comes to mobile operating systems. If your audience aligns with the demographics of iOS users, it is a great idea to go with an iOS app development services provider and create an app for this platform. The same goes with the Android, but the aim stays broader.

Development Costs and Timeline


After the target audience, another factor that differentiates the development choice between iOS and Android is development costs and timelines. For iOS development, it is generally more straightforward because there is a limited number of devices and operating system versions, so you are mostly creating for the newest iPhone, and all other devices absorb it.

But, with Android, the case is different because of a diverse range of devices and OS versions, which require more optimization and take up the development costs and timelines. While it is difficult to get exact numbers, Android development takes 20-30% longer than iOS.

Monetization Strategies


The monetization strategies have a strong influence on the choice of platform. iOS users are generally more willing to pay for apps and in-app purchases for getting premium experiences everywhere.

Whereas Android apps mostly have an ad-based monetization model, so users get to see more advertisements. If your app relies on paid downloads, then iOS may give you a higher return on investment. But ad-based revenue is more in the Android department.

Technical Considerations


From a technical perspective, iOS development has two options, Swift and Objective C, while Android development uses Java or Kotlin. Both these platforms have their own set of development tools and frameworks. If you go with iOS development, you are going to get a more streamlined development process and a user experience that stays consistent throughout the journey. The Android ecosystem is open source in nature and gives more flexibility and customization.
